Score 90-93/100 · Drink 2001-2009, Pierre Rovani, Oct 1999

Crafted from old vines located in the middle of Clos St.-Denis, Potel's 1997 is ruby/purple-colored. Its restrained yet super-ripe aromatics lead to a profound personality packed with jammy cherries. Medium to full-bodied, and offering outstanding grip, elegance, and power, this harmonious and well-structured wine should of capable of mid-term cellaring. Drink it between 2001-2009.
